Summaryinfo

A vulnerability marked as critical has been reported in MicroWorld eScan Internet Security Suite 14.0.1400.2029. This impacts an unknown function in the library econceal.sys of the component Driver. This manipulation as part of Request causes memory corruption (Blue Screen). This vulnerability is registered as CVE-2018-10098. The attack needs to be launched locally. No exploit is available.

Detailsinfo

A vulnerability has been found in MicroWorld eScan Internet Security Suite 14.0.1400.2029 and classified as critical. Affected by this vulnerability is an unknown code in the library econceal.sys of the component Driver. The manipulation as part of a Request leads to a memory corruption vulnerability (Blue Screen). The CWE definition for the vulnerability is CWE-119. The product performs operations on a memory buffer, but it can read from or write to a memory location that is outside of the intended boundary of the buffer. As an impact it is known to affect availability. The summary by CVE is:

In MicroWorld eScan Internet Security Suite (ISS) for Business 14.0.1400.2029, the driver econceal.sys allows a non-privileged user to send a 0x830020E0 IOCTL request to \\.\econceal to cause a denial of service (BSOD).

The bug was discovered 07/12/2018. The weakness was published 07/13/2018 as not defined mailinglist post (Full-Disclosure). The advisory is shared at seclists.org. This vulnerability is known as CVE-2018-10098 since 04/13/2018. The exploitation appears to be easy. An attack has to be approached locally. The exploitation doesn't need any form of authentication. Technical details are known, but no exploit is available. The price for an exploit might be around USD $0-$5k at the moment (estimation calculated on 03/04/2020).

The vulnerability was handled as a non-public zero-day exploit for at least 1 days. During that time the estimated underground price was around $0-$5k.

There is no information about possible countermeasures known. It may be suggested to replace the affected object with an alternative product.
